温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

数据库备份与恢复策略在php中应用

发布时间:2024-12-28 01:44:50 来源:亿速云 阅读:80 作者:小樊 栏目:编程语言

数据库备份与恢复策略在PHP中的应用,主要是通过PHP脚本执行数据库备份命令或调用相关函数,以实现数据的备份和恢复。以下是关于数据库备份与恢复策略在PHP中应用的相关信息:

数据库备份策略

  • 使用mysqldump命令:通过PHP的shell_exec()exec()函数执行mysqldump命令,导出数据库结构和数据。
  • 使用数据库内置的备份功能:如MySQL和PostgreSQL提供的内置备份功能,可以通过PHP执行相应的命令。
  • 使用第三方库:如Ifsnop/mysqldump-php和doctrine/dbal等,提供高级功能如压缩备份文件、加密备份数据等。
  • 定时备份:使用操作系统的任务计划器(如cron)或PHP的定时器功能来定期执行数据库备份脚本。
  • 增量备份和差异备份:节省存储空间和提高备份速度,可与mysqldump命令结合使用,或使用第三方库实现。
  • 加密备份文件:保护敏感数据,可以使用PHP的加密函数或第三方库来实现。
  • 压缩备份文件:减小文件大小,节省存储空间和网络传输时间,可以使用PHP的压缩函数或第三方库来实现。

数据库恢复策略

  • 从备份或损坏的数据库中检索数据:确定问题,评估数据状态和重要性,获取备份文件,使用PHP连接数据库,执行SQL恢复脚本,检查数据完整性,处理异常和错误,更新应用程序,文档记录。
  • 使用备份文件:检查数据库的备份文件,停止数据库服务,创建临时数据库,恢复数据库备份文件,检查数据库完整性,恢复数据库服务,测试数据库连接。

通过上述方法,可以有效地进行数据库的备份与恢复,确保数据的安全性和可靠性。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

php
AI